Course description
The NPA Professional Cookery course is delivered within the professional kitchens at West Lothian College as part of the school’s travel column. Students will work with lecturers with outstanding industry experience, learning not just the basics but also gaining an understanding of modern cookery techniques.
The course introduces students to techniques that are important in professional cookery. It develops practical, technical and transferable skills in food preparation and cooking, and provides bite-sized chunks of learning that are straightforward for learners to study covering:The Professional Cookery department is vibrant and engaging. Students get the opportunity to take part in hospitality events and to apply their learning in the award-winning training restaurant ‘The Terrace Restaurant’.
Learning outcome
Education: The NPA in Professional Cookery is designed to equip students with the skills and knowledge required to progress onto full-time college programmes such as the National Certificate (NC) in Professional Cookery at SCCF level 5.
Employment: The NPA in Professional Cookery enables successful candidates to seek employment in the hospitality and catering industry, eg as commis chef/chef apprentice.
Entry requirements
The NPA is aimed at candidates who may be interested in pursuing a career in the catering industry but who have limited prior experience of cookery.
